There is a range of optional functions arranged during Congress which you may be interested in attending:
Opening FunctionThe Opening Function will be held in the Dome at the Auckland Museum from 7pm to 9 pm on Friday, 16
January. This will be a Cocktail Function and will include a welcome, a few formal speeches with plenty of
time
allowed for mixing and mingling, catching up with friends from past
Congresses and making new friends in the genealogy world.
We won't mind if you daydream while admiring Auckland from this
magnificent vantage point with 360 degree views.
Congress BanquetThe
Congress Banquet will be held on Monday, 19 January, 2009 in the ASB
Lounge at Eden Park, the home of the famous New Zealand All
Blacks. This will be a lavish buffet dinner with great
entertainment.
Presentation of the AFFHO awards will be made at this dinner. An occasion not to be missed.
Pre and Post Congress Tours Auckland Research Repositories Tour arranged for Friday 16 January 9am – 4pm and Wednesday 21 January.
A scenic day tour of Auckland has been arranged for our out of town visitors.
NZSG Family Research Centre visitsIncluded
in the programme is the opportunity to research at the NZSG Family
Research Centre in Panmure. Special sessions have been
arranged for Saturday and Sunday evenings from 7pm to 10pm.
This is limited to 35 only per evening. The centre will be
open for research prior to and after the Congress.
